How to Convert Btu to Joule

1 Btu = 1055.06 Joules

Joule = Btu × 1055.06

Example: 125 Btu × 1055.06 = 131880 J

Reverse Conversion

To convert Joules back to Btu:

  • Remember, 1 joule equals 0.000947817 Btu.
  • To convert 131880 J to Btu, multiply 131880 x 0.000947817, resulting in 125 Btu.

About these units

Btu: British thermal unit (IT) — legacy heat unit based on heating water.

Joule: SI unit of energy: 1 J = 1 N·m = 1 kg·m²·s⁻².
